2 St Keyes Close, Landkey, Barnstaple, EX32 0HF is a freehold detached property built between 1983-1990. The property offers approximately 1,055 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£336,754 , which equates to approximately £319 per square foot. It was last sold on 30 Jan 2020 for £285,000. Since then, the value has increased by £51,754, representing a 18.2% increase, or approximately 2.8% per year.

The current estimated value of £336,754 is:

  • 0.7% lower than the average property price on St Keyes Close
  • 2.9% lower than the average in the EX32 0HF postcode area
  • and 26.6% higher than the average price for Barnstaple as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 16 October 2019,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

2 St Keyes Close, Landkey, Barnstaple, North Devon, Devon, EX32 0HF has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 16 Oct 2019.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 8 Jun 2009, when the property was rated E. Since then, the rating has improved to D,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 70%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system was upgraded from boiler and radiators, oil to boiler and radiators, mains gas, improving energy efficiency from average to good.
  • The hot water system was changed from from main system, no cylinderstat to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from poor to good.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from roof room(s), insulated to pitched, insulated (assumed), with no change in energy efficiency (average).
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, no insulation (assumed) to cavity wall, as built, insulated (assumed), improving energy efficiency from poor to good.
  • The lighting was changed from low energy lighting in 50%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 69% of fixed outlets, with no change in efficiency (good).
